Iran War Live Updates: Worker Killed in Kuwait Amid Gulf Tensions; Israel Intercepts Drones from Yemen

The ongoing conflict involving Iran continues to escalate with serious incidents reported across the Gulf region. In a current development, an Indian worker has been killed in Kuwait due to an attack attributed to Iran. This incident highlights the increasing reach and impact of the hostilities in the Gulf, as tensions between Iran and its regional adversaries remain high.

Kuwaiti officials have confirmed the death of the worker, emphasizing the severity of the situation and the potential for further escalation. The incident has raised concerns about the safety of foreign nationals working in the Gulf amid the ongoing turmoil.

Meanwhile, Israel has reported successfully intercepting drones launched from Yemen, further complicating the conflict dynamics. These drone strikes are believed to be supported by Iranian-backed groups operating in Yemen, aiming to target Israeli territory or assets.

The Gulf region has seen a series of attacks and counterattacks recently, with Iran and its proxies engaging in various military and covert operations. The situation has drawn international attention, with calls for de-escalation and diplomatic efforts to prevent a full-scale war.

The killing in Kuwait and the drone interceptions by Israel underscore the increasing involvement of multiple countries and factions in the conflict, marking a dangerous expansion beyond traditional battlegrounds.

Security experts warn that the continuation of such attacks could destabilize the Gulf further, impacting global energy supplies and international trade routes passing through critical chokepoints like the Strait of Hormuz.

Governments around the world are closely monitoring the developments, with some strengthening their security measures and urging citizens in the region to exercise caution.

The incident in Kuwait also reverberates on a humanitarian level, as many migrant workers in the Gulf face heightened risks due to the conflict.

Political analysts suggest that the situation remains fluid and unpredictable, with diplomatic channels striving to find a resolution amid increasing hostilities.

The interception of drones by Israel indicates an elevated threat level and the possibility of more sophisticated and frequent attacks as the conflict persists.

This multifaceted conflict draws in not only regional powers but also international stakeholders, given the strategic importance of the Gulf and its resources.

In summary, the Iranian conflict has entered a perilous phase with the death of an Indian worker in Kuwait and Israel’s interception of drones from Yemen. These events starkly illustrate the widening scope of violence and potential for broader confrontation in the Gulf region. Authorities and international communities face pressing challenges in navigating this crisis to prevent further loss of life and regional destabilization.
